Def Jam Executive Vice President Shakir Stewart committed suicide today in New York, according to reports.

Stewart succeeded Jay-Z at Def Jam in June, while retaining his duties as Senior Vice President of A&R at Island Def Jam. The Oakland, CA native signed artists including Young Jeezy and Rick Ross to the legendary label. He came to the company from Hitco Publishing, where he signed Beyoncé to the firm.

“The bold young management style that Shakir has established at Def Jam is one of the major reasons behind the label’s success today,” said Island Def Jam Chairman Antonio “L.A.” Reid in a statement from June.

UPDATE: Reps at Def Jam have confirmed Stewart’s death. He reportedly died of a self-inflicted gunshot wound to the head.
